Faerie Fire, Healing Word, Fog Cloud, Thunderwave, Enhance Ability, Barkskin and Lesser Restoration are always good to have low level spells.

Conjure Animals would work on sea beasts. Water Breathing would obivously be great unless they've another way to breathe underwater. Maybe Water Walk if they enter caverns and want to walk across some water instead of go swimming. Control Water seems like it could be used very creatively. Polymorph is powerful in general. Hallucinatory Terrain could be good as well. Maybe Ice storm and Dominate Beast.

Of course, for combat, you should mostly be in your wild shape.

You actually can't do CR 3. Text from the book reads as follows (concerning Moon Druid shapeshifting)

Page 69, bottom left corner. Starting at 6th level, you can transform into a beast with a challenge rating as high as your druid level divided by 3, rounded down.

Once you're level 9, you'll have access to CR 3 beasts.
